Warts are non-cancerous growths caused by the human papillomavirus (HPV). They can appear on any part of the body and come in various shapes and sizes. By understanding the nature of warts, you can better grasp the treatment options available. **Exploring Treatment Options** **Over-the-Counter (OTC) Treatments** Salicylic Acid: A common OTC treatment that gradually breaks down the wart tissue, causing it to peel away over time. Cryotherapy: Involves freezing the wart with liquid nitrogen, leading to the destruction of wart tissue and subsequent removal. Duct Tape Occlusion: Covering the wart with duct tape can suffocate it, eventually causing it to fall off. **Prescription Treatments** Cantharidin: Applied to the wart, cantharidin causes blistering, facilitating wart removal. Immunotherapy: Stimulates the body's immune system to fight the wart virus, often through topical medications or injections. Surgical Removal: For stubborn or large warts, surgical removal may be necessary through excision, laser surgery, or electrocautery. **Natural Remedies** Apple Cider Vinegar: Applied directly to the wart, apple cider vinegar may help break down tissue and promote healing. Tea Tree Oil: With its antiviral properties, tea tree oil can be applied topically to reduce inflammation and aid in wart removal.
